Transaction 1f07d580226a605860d5d5350023143372fb69821d54c6ff209761fec64a4d18
1 Input
1 Output
-
1f07d580226a605860d5d5350023143372fb69821d54c6ff209761fec64a4d18:0
- value
- 533341
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fc242b2fad6b8e6251a472129bb101dc9e8e45d
- address
- bc1qelpy9vh666uwvfg6gusjnwcsrhy73ezad0vhu4